Product Description

Today yoga is a thoroughly globalised phenomenon. Yoga has taken the world by storm and is even seeing renewed popularity in India. Both in India and abroad, adults, children and teenagers are practicing yoga in diverse settings; gyms, schools, home, work, yoga studios and temples. The yoga diaspora began well over a hundred years ago and we continue to see new manifestations and uses of Yoga in the modern world.

As the first of its kind this collection draws together cutting edge scholarship in the field, focusing on the theory and practice of yoga in contemporary times. Offering a range of perspectives on yoga's contemporary manifestations, it maps the movement, development and consolidation of yoga in global settings. The collection features some of the most well-known authors within the field and newer voices. The contributions span a number of disciplines in the humanities, including, anthropology, Philosophy, Studies in Religion and Asian studies, offering a range of entry points to the issues involved in the study of the subject. As such, is of use to those involved in academic scholarship, as well as to the growing number of yoga practitioners who seek a deeper account of the origin and significance of the techniques and traditions they are engaging with. It will also-and perhaps most of all-speak to the growing numbers of 'scholar-practitioners' who straddle these two realms.

This collection of essays contains some of the most thought provoking writing on the topic of modern yoga ever published. Some of the work is potentially unsettling for people who are deeply committed to their asana practice. The essays reveal a variety of truths, semi-truths and downright misconceptions around the subject. Leaves you with the mat pulled from under your feet but also with a capacity to make sense of things about your yoga that have perhaps been a bit hazy up till now. If you are a serious student with an academic bent or a teacher of yoga I think this makes essential reading - however the outrageous price tag will probably put it out of reach for many. Every good library should have one.
